def p2():
inp = get_input(pw)
nmbrs = {int(x): y + 1 for y, x in enumerate(inp[:-1])}
last = int(inp[-1])
for i in range(len(nmbrs) + 1, 30000000):
if last not in nmbrs:
nmbrs[last] = i
last = 0
else:
prev, nmbrs[last] = nmbrs[last], i
last = i - prev
print(last)
